When it comes to pet care, especially for cat owners, the choice of litter can significantly impact both the environment and plumbing systems. A rising trend in cat litter options is flushable tofu cat litter, made from natural ingredients and marketed as a more eco-friendly alternative. However, many pet owners wonder: is it safe to flush this type of litter down their plumbing systems?

Expert Opinions on Flushable Tofu Cat Litter

To gain a better understanding of the safety of flushable tofu cat litter for plumbing systems, we consulted several industry experts and veterinarians. Here’s what they had to say:

Dr. Emily Nguyen, Veterinary Specialist

Dr. Nguyen emphasizes the benefits of using flushable tofu cat litter. “Tofu litter is made from biodegradable materials, which means it’s a better option for the environment than traditional clay litters. However, flushing it can become an issue if your plumbing system isn't designed to handle organic waste.” She recommends checking local regulations since some municipalities discourage flushing anything other than toilet paper and human waste.

Mark Thompson, Plumbing Expert

From a plumbing standpoint, Mark Thompson warns, “While flushable tofu cat litter is marketed as safe for plumbing, I’ve seen firsthand that it can cause clogs in older plumbing systems. The litter can expand when wet, making it more likely to get stuck in pipes.” He suggests pet owners consider their home’s plumbing age and condition before deciding to flush any type of litter.

Sara Jennings, Environmental Consultant

Sara Jennings highlights potential environmental benefits, stating, “When disposed of correctly, flushable tofu cat litter can reduce landfill waste. However, flushing should always be considered with caution, as not all wastewater treatment facilities are equipped to process this type of organic material.” She advocates for composting as an alternative, where allowed, to minimize environmental impact.

Considerations for Cat Owners

With mixed opinions from experts, here are some considerations for cat owners thinking about using flushable tofu cat litter:

Check Your Plumbing System

Before flushing any type of litter, assess your plumbing system’s age and condition. If you have older pipes, it may be safer to avoid flushing altogether.

Research Local Regulations

Some municipalities have strict regulations regarding what can be flushed. Always check local guidelines to ensure you’re compliant.

Evaluate Alternative Disposal Methods

If flushing poses potential risks, consider composting or using a designated trash bin for waste disposal. This will not only protect your plumbing but also contribute to more sustainable waste management.

Conclusion

In conclusion, while flushable tofu cat litter presents a convenient and eco-friendly option, its safety for plumbing systems depends on various factors, including the specific plumbing infrastructure of your home and local waste regulations. It’s essential to weigh the pros and cons carefully and consult with professionals if in doubt. By taking a thoughtful approach, cat owners can enjoy the benefits of a more sustainable cat litter option while maintaining the integrity of their plumbing systems.
